Re: Multithreading Kategorie: Programmierung C (von PeterS - 17.03.2008 9:34) | |
Als Antwort auf Re: Multithreading von Werner L - 17.03.2008 8:51
| |
> > Ist ein Bug und auch in der neuen Version behoben. > > > > Gruss Peter > > > > > Hallo Kollegen, > > > ich habe Probleme bei Multithreading Programmen, und zwar wirkt der Befehl > > > Thread_Wait(ithread, #) nicht auf den angegebenen Thread Ithread sonder immer nur auf den > > > aufrufenden Thread. > > > Ist das so und habe ich die Programmieranleitung falsch verstanden? Oder gibt es einen Trick bzw. > > > Beschränkungen? > > > Ich möchte bei ausgewählten Aktivitäten in einem der Threads einen anderen Thread > > > ausschlie�en und nach den Aktivitäten (Eingaben mit Tasten am I2C-Bus) mit Thread_Signal(#) > > > wieder freigeben. > > > Das Problem habe ich jetzt mit Thread_Kill(ithread) und Thread_Start(ithread, xxx) gelöst. > > > > > > Vielen Dank für einen Hinweis > > > Werner L > > vielen Dank für den Hinweise, > und welche ist die neue Version? Ich nutze die V 1.63 an Mega 32 und 128 Ich arbeite seit Anfang Januar an Version 1.70. Die hoffentlich in den nächsten 14 Tagen soweit gedebugged ist, das sie veröffentlicht werden kann. Gruss Peter > > Danke > Werner L | |
Antwort schreiben Antworten: |
Zur Übersicht - INFO - Neueste 50 Beiträge - Neuer Beitrag - Suchen - Zum C-Control-I-Forum - Zum C-Control-II-Forum